dpkg-reconfigure: quais pacotes são suportados?

2

dpkg-reconfigure oferece uma maneira de definir opções para pacotes instalados de maneira "amigável" (por exemplo, não editando arquivos, mas selecionando em caixas de diálogo).

Como posso descobrir qual pacote tem essas opções? por exemplo. " dpkg-reconfigure tzdata " tem isso enquanto " dpkg-reconfigure nano " não tem.

Qual é o argumento / pacote correto para adicionar um apt-mirror adicional via dpkg-reconfigure do "modo de diálogo"?

    
por chris01 20.06.2018 / 08:30

1 resposta

5

Diálogos em scripts de configuração de pacotes Debian são tipicamente manipulados por debconf ; Os pacotes que suportam isso terão arquivos .config e .templates correspondentes em /var/lib/dpkg/info ( por exemplo, /var/lib/dpkg/info/tzdata.config e /var/lib/dpkg/info/tzdata.templates ). (Isso também oferece outros benefícios, como suporte simples para pré-semeadura).

A execução de dpkg-reconfigure executa o script postinst do mantenedor de um pacote no modo configure , portanto, o que acontece quando você faz isso realmente depende do que o mantenedor fornece. A maioria dos pacotes é projetada para instalação silenciosa, por isso, eles não fornecem configurações interativas via dpkg-reconfigure .

Espelhos apt adicionais são configurados por um módulo instalador, não por um script postinst e, até onde eu sei, não está disponível após a instalação.

    
por 20.06.2018 / 08:57